Bomb Cyclone Batters East Coast: Strong Winds, Flooding, and Widespread Power Outages in Maine

December 11, 2024 — A powerful bomb cyclone wreaked havoc along the East Coast, bringing intense winds, heavy rain, and snow that disrupted daily life from the Mid-Atlantic to New England. Maine was among the hardest-hit states, with tens of thousands of residents left without power as Versant Power crews raced to restore electricity.

Severe Weather Impact

The storm, which intensified rapidly into a bomb cyclone, unleashed damaging winds exceeding 60 mph in some areas. Ski resorts across the East Coast faced chaotic conditions as gusts closed lifts and buried slopes under fresh snowfall. Coastal areas endured flooding rains, while inland regions grappled with treacherous, icy conditions.

Maine bore the brunt of the storm’s fury. Versant Power reported over 40,000 outages at the peak of the storm, with restoration efforts slowed by continued high winds and debris-covered roads.

Restoration Efforts Underway

Versant Power has deployed additional crews to the hardest-hit areas, working around the clock to restore service. “Our teams are making progress, but the combination of strong winds and freezing temperatures presents challenges,” the utility said in a statement.

What’s Next?

Meteorologists warn that the storm could leave behind lake-effect snow in parts of upstate New York and Pennsylvania, potentially complicating cleanup efforts. Meanwhile, coastal regions face ongoing flood risks as tides rise in the storm’s wake.

Public Response

Authorities are urging residents to avoid unnecessary travel and to check on vulnerable neighbors. In Maine, warming centers have been established to provide relief to those without heat or electricity.
